Over 60 acres destroyed by Imbulpe wild fire

by Staff Writer 30-07-2018 | 5:13 PM
COLOMBO (News 1st) - The fire that erupted on the Parawiyangala mountain in Imbulpe, Balangoda is continuing to spread according to the Divisional Secretary of Imbulpe. He said that attempts to control the fire since last night (July 29) have been unsuccessful and that over 60 acres had already been destroyed by the fire. The Divisional secretary said that six suspects have been arrested on charges of beginning the fire. The Parawiyangala mountain in Imbulpe is known as "Adara Kanda" among the university students of Sri Lanka.
